ITEM 5. COMMON STOCK OWNERSHIP OF CERTAIN BENEFICIAL OWNERS AND MANAGEMENT

     Business Resource Group (the "Company" or the "Registrant") is making this
voluntary filing under Item 5 of the instructions on Information to be Included
in the Report on Form 8-K in order to provide security holders with more current
information than that contained in the Registrant's Annual Proxy Statement filed
on January 30, 1998 on Schedule 14A (the "Proxy Statement") concerning ownership
of the Registrant's securities by certain persons. The information contained in
this Report has been prepared in accordance with the applicable requirements of
Schedule 14A to which the disclosure relates.

     The following table sets forth the beneficial ownership of the Registrant's
Common Stock as of November 30, 1998 as to (i) each person who is known by the
Registrant to own beneficially more than five percent of the Registrant's Common
Stock, (ii) each of the Registrant's directors, (iii) each of the executive
officers named in the Summary Compensation Table beginning on page 14 of the
Proxy Statement, and (iv) all directors and executive officers as a group.
